The Karate Kid is a 2010 martial arts drama film directed by Harald Zwart and produced by Jerry Weintraub, Will Smith, Jada Pinkett Smith, James Lassiter, and Ken Stovitz, from a screenplay written by Christopher Murphey, based on a story conceived by Robert Mark Kamen, the writer of the first three Karate Kid films.   7. The Karate Kid es una historia semiautobiográfica basada en la vida de su guionista, Robert Mark Kamen. A los 17 años, después de la Feria Mundial de Nueva York de 1964 , Kamen fue golpeado por una banda de matones. Así empezó a estudiar artes marciales para poder defenderse.
